Picking Out the Right Outdoor Sofa
When purchasing outdoor furniture sofas, construction types are key. Powder-coated aluminium frames are portable and durable, making them long-lasting. Timber options, such as hardwoods, offer a more natural aesthetic and age well over time.
Synthetic rattan designs, usually made from woven polymer, balance durability and comfort. Cushions should be quick-drying, with removable covers for cleaning ease. Fabrics that don’t fade easily help retain colour vibrancy through the seasons.

Popular Layouts
- L-shaped Sofas: Make good use of corners and maximise seating.
- Flexible Units: Move and adapt pieces based on space.
- Two- and Three-Seaters: Ideal for tight areas where space is tight.
- Sofa-Dining Combinations: Merge casual lounging with an dining-height table for meals.
Space-Saving Outdoor Sofas
For limited outdoor areas, consider two-seaters that offer a snug place to sit without cluttering the space. Hidden storage beneath seats can be used to stash cushions, throws, or covers.
Collapsible versions are convenient for winter when season changes. Opting for natural colours helps maintain a spacious feel in small areas.

FAQs
- Are outdoor sofas weatherproof? Most outdoor sofas are designed for rain and sun, especially those with aluminium frames and quick-dry cushions. Waterproof sheets will further increase lifespan.
- Can I leave my sofa outside all year? You can, but it’s advisable to use covers or relocate them during wet seasons.
- Which materials last the longest outdoors? Resin wicker, treated metal, and teak offer long-lasting performance.
- Do outdoor sofas need a lot of upkeep? Generally, minimal effort is needed. Wipe down frames and clean cushions when not in use.
- Can I use indoor cushions outside? It’s not recommended. Indoor cushions can deteriorate quickly when left exposed.
